πŸ”Œ

REST API AI Integration

Custom & API

Looking for a custom REST API AI integration? JoySuite connects to any REST API endpoint, giving AI assistants access to internal systems, proprietary databases, and custom services. Ask questions in natural language, query data from any source, and build powerful integrationsβ€”without writing code.

Access Mode
Read & Write
Setup Time
~10 minutes
Auth Method
API Key
Coming Soon

Connect REST API to JoySuite

Enable your AI assistants to access data from any REST API endpoint. Build powerful integrations without custom development.

Join Waitlist

What You Can Do

Your internal systems hold valuable data, but accessing it requires technical knowledge or custom development.

Query internal systems instantly

"Pull the latest inventory levels from our warehouse API"

No custom development required.

Get data from any source

"Get all orders from our e-commerce API placed today"

Query any REST endpoint.

Search custom databases naturally

"Find all accounts created this month"

Query your data without SQL.

Monitor system status

"Check the status of our payment gateway"

Get real-time health checks.

Configure multiple endpoints

"Query our product catalog and pricing APIs"

Connect as many endpoints as needed.

Connect REST APIs to everything else

"What internal data relates to accounts in my CRM?"

Combine custom systems with other integrations.

No custom development required. Connect in 10 minutes.

What Your Assistants Can Access

JoySuite securely connects to REST API, making these resources available to your AI assistants.

🌐

API Endpoints

Configure and access multiple REST API endpoints with different base URLs and paths.

Base URL Path Method Response Format Rate Limits
πŸ”

Authentication

Support for multiple authentication methods to secure your connections.

API Keys Bearer Tokens OAuth 2.0 Basic Auth
πŸ“‹

Headers

Configure custom headers for authorization, content type, and more.

Authorization Content-Type Accept Custom Headers
πŸ”

Query Parameters

Filter and search API data using query strings and parameters.

Filters Sorting Pagination Search Terms Date Ranges
πŸ“¦

Request Body

Send structured data in POST and PUT requests with JSON or form data.

JSON Payload Form Data File Uploads Nested Objects
πŸ”„

Webhooks

Configure incoming webhooks to receive real-time data updates.

Payload Event Type Timestamp Signature

Connector Commands

Use these specialized commands to interact with your REST API data directly in conversations.

/api get

Fetch Data

Retrieve data from any configured GET endpoint.

/api post

Send Data

Submit data to a POST endpoint and return the response.

/api search

Search Records

Query API endpoints with filters and search parameters.

/api list

List Endpoints

View all configured API endpoints and their descriptions.

/api schema

View Schema

Display the expected request and response structure.

/api test

Test Connection

Verify API connectivity and authentication status.

Connect REST API to Your Other Tools

Combine REST API data with other connected systems for deeper insights.

πŸ”§
+
☁️

REST API + Salesforce Integration

Correlate custom system data with Salesforce accounts for complete customer context.

Unified customer view
πŸ”§
+
πŸ’¬

REST API + Slack Integration

Surface custom system data when relevant topics are discussed in Slack channels.

Real-time context
πŸ”§
+
πŸ“Š

REST API + Tableau Integration

Combine proprietary data with analytics platforms for comprehensive reporting.

Complete data picture
πŸ”§
+
⚑

REST API + Zapier Integration

Extend custom API integrations with automated Zapier workflows.

Extended automation

Permissions & Access Control

You control exactly what JoySuite can access within REST API.

Default

Read Access

Standard access level for searching and retrieving data.

  • Search and query records
  • View record details and history
  • Access related records and associations
  • View reports and dashboards
Optional

Write Access

Extended permissions for creating and modifying records.

  • Create new records
  • Update existing records
  • Add notes and activities
  • Manage associations

Frequently Asked Questions

Does JoySuite store data from my API?

No. JoySuite connects to your REST API and queries data in real-time. Your data stays in your systemsβ€”JoySuite just makes it searchable through AI.

What authentication methods are supported?

JoySuite supports API keys, Bearer tokens, OAuth 2.0, and Basic authentication. You can configure the authentication method that matches your API.

Can JoySuite write data to my API?

Yes. JoySuite can execute POST, PUT, and PATCH requests if your API supports them. Write permissions are optional and configurable.

How long does setup take?

About 10 minutes. Configure your endpoint URLs, authentication, and start asking questions about your data.

Can I connect multiple APIs?

Yes. You can configure multiple API endpoints with different base URLs, authentication methods, and access patterns.

Related Connectors

These connectors work great alongside REST API.

Ready to Connect REST API?

Give your AI assistants access to your REST API data. Get started in minutes.

Join Waitlist